Car: R33 gtst 1994

MODS: apexpi pfc

nismo fuel reg

slide performance highflow turbo stage 3

hiflo exhaust 3inch-split dump

bosch fuel pump internal

z32 afm

garret wastegate acuator new

15 psi

tuned

My problem is when i reach around 5-6000 rpm it looses power,and boost reading drops excessivley as if somthing has blocked the air intake.

has anybody had this problem?i have checked all pipes and fittings?

I've got this exact same problem. Sometimes I get a loud whistling type sound in the higher RPMs. I've only got some basic bolt on mods, FMIC, split front/dump pipe, high flow cat, manual b/c at 10psi. Mine drops off to next to no boost past 5000rpm. My friends Dad had a look at it tonight, he's a nissan mechanic. We weren't able to solve the problem unfortunately. Got us pretty stumped.

your joking john isnt that silicon hose sposed to eliminate that problem (sucking close) if so its a complete waste of money,im gonna put my stock inlet pipe on and reinforce it,did the problem go away for you onced rienforced??

I regret buying it, wasted $150... was pretty worthless! Re-enforced it all sweet, I don't get a boost drop anymore!

if you squeeze it you'll notice its actually softer than the stock pipe!

  • 2 weeks later...

If your intake pipe is sucking closed, that suggests to me that your air filter is too restrictive. Take the air filter off and go for a quick drive, see if it's still an issue, but avoid any dirt roads!
